The book ""Commercial Precedents Selected From The Column Of Replies And Decisions Of The New York Journal Of Commerce: An Essential Work Of Reference For Every Business Man"" was written by Charles Putzel and published in 1881. The book contains a collection of legal precedents and decisions pertaining to commercial law, selected from the column of replies and decisions of the New York Journal of Commerce. It is intended to serve as an essential reference work for business people, providing them with valuable insights into the legal aspects of commercial transactions. The book covers a wide range of topics, including contracts, partnerships, sales, shipping, insurance, and bankruptcy. It is written in a clear and concise style, making it accessible to both legal professionals and laypeople.
